In addition to reducing emissions outlined in the Districts Clean Corridor Plan, these new zero emission buses (ZEB) will enhance service quality by replacing old diesel buses that are past their useful life. Adding more zero emission buses will also assist in the District meeting the California Air Resources Board (CARB) Innovative Clean Transit (ICT) regulation.

BUDGETARY/FISCAL IMPACT:

The purchase of the forty (40) zero emission buses is fully funded by various state sources, including the Transit and Intercity Rail Capital Program (TIRCP) and Senate Bill 1 Local Partnership Program (SB1 LLP) funds. The project is programmed in FY2019-20 - FY2023-24 Capital Improvement Plan and will cost approximately $46.5 million The project will be funded entirely with grant funds, no District funds will be needed.

BACKGROUND/RATIONALE:

Grants were originally secured for the purchase of forty-five (45) high-capacity zero-emission buses (ZEBs) on the MacArthur Clean Corridor and a new service between Emeryville Amtrak Station and San Francisco. As these buses are not yet commercially available, staff discussed the option of purchasing forty-foot ZEBs with the granting agencies and received no objections.
